    Competitive Landscape of the Hydrogen Generator Market: A Thriving Vista with Shifting Sands


    The global hydrogen generator market is witnessing a surge of activity, spurred by rising decarbonization efforts and the burgeoning hydrogen economy. This rapidly evolving landscape is marked by established players vying for market dominance alongside innovative startups disrupting traditional approaches. To navigate this dynamic panorama, understanding the key strategies, trends, and factors shaping the competitive landscape is paramount.


    Giants Maneuvering for Advantage:


    Leading players like Air Liquide, Air Products & Chemicals, and Praxair are leveraging their extensive experience and established distribution networks to secure market share. These giants are aggressively investing in research and development (R&D) to optimize existing technologies like steam methane reforming (SMR) and explore greener options like proton-exchange membrane (PEM) electrolysis. Additionally, strategic partnerships with fuel cell developers and hydrogen infrastructure providers are bolstering their portfolios and diversifying their offerings.


    Nimble New Entrants Stirring the Pot:


    Emerging companies like McPhy Energy, NEL Hydrogen, and ITM Power are challenging the status quo with innovative solutions focusing on efficiency, portability, and affordability. They are pioneering advancements in PEM electrolysis technology, catering to niche applications like on-site hydrogen generation for remote locations or backup power systems. Moreover, their agile business models and focus on customer customization are resonating with a growing segment of the market.

    Emerging Trends: Reshaping the Horizon:


    Several trends are transforming the competitive landscape:


    Renewable Integration: The integration of renewable energy sources like solar and wind power into hydrogen generation through electrolysis is fostering green hydrogen production, unlocking new market segments and attracting sustainability-focused investors.


    Modularization and Decentralization: Compact and mobile hydrogen generators are gaining traction, catering to decentralized applications like transportation fueling stations and powering off-grid communities. This opens doors for new entrants and challenges established players to adapt their product offerings.


    Digitalization and Automation: Integrating advanced data analytics and automation into hydrogen generation systems is optimizing efficiency, reducing operational costs, and enabling remote monitoring. This trend necessitates investments in technological upgrades and upskilling the workforce.
